πŸ’° COST & AFFORDABILITY
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
πŸ’Έ Cost of Living + 5.6 -- 150 Hasselt is moderately expensive, reflecting the high standard of living and taxation typical of Belgium, though it is slightly more affordable than major hubs like Brussels.
🏠 Accommodation Cost + 4.7 -- 80 Rental demand is steady and prices have risen relative to regional averages; finding short-term furnished leases can be challenging and costly.
🍎 Food & Groceries + 5.9 -- 40 Supermarket prices are standard for Western Europe, while dining out at restaurants remains relatively expensive due to high labor costs.
🚌 Transportation Cost + 7.0 -- 20 Public transport is efficient and reliable, though owning a car entails significant taxation and fuel costs; cycling is the most cost-effective local transit mode.
🎟️ Entertainment Cost + 5.7 -- 15 Leisure activities like cinema, pubs, and cultural events are priced at typical Belgian levels, which are generally high compared to global averages.
πŸ‹οΈ Gym Membership Cost + 6.8 -- 10 There is a good range of gym options, from budget-friendly chains to premium fitness centers, keeping memberships reasonably accessible.
πŸ’± Currency Stability + 9.5 -- 30 As part of the Eurozone, the currency is highly stable and widely accepted, offering excellent security for digital nomad financial planning.
🌟 QUALITY OF LIFE
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
βš–οΈ Work-Life Balance + 8.7 -- 30 Hasselt embodies the Belgian 'slow living' culture with a strong emphasis on leisure, cycling, and short commutes, perfectly suited for a balanced nomad lifestyle.
🌳 Environmental Quality + 7.7 -- 15 The city features extensive green spaces, the lush Kapermolen Park, and a commitment to urban planning that integrates nature seamlessly into the city center.
🧼 Cleanliness + 8.7 -- 10 As one of Belgium's most well-maintained cities, streets are consistently spotless and public infrastructure is kept in excellent condition.
πŸ—¨οΈ Language Barrier + 6.6 -- 30 Dutch is the official language, but English proficiency among the local population is exceptionally high, making social and professional integration very easy.
πŸ’¨ Air Quality + 6.5 -- 15 While it remains better than major industrial hubs, the air quality is typical of a mid-sized European city with moderate traffic and some regional industrial influence.
πŸ‘¨β€πŸ‘©β€πŸ‘§β€πŸ‘¦ Family Friendly + 8.5 -- 25 With world-class schools, safe bike-friendly streets, and numerous family-oriented attractions like Plopsa Indoor, it is an ideal environment for nomad families.

🌿 CLIMATE & ENVIRONMENT
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
β˜€οΈ Weather + 3.7 -- 80 Hasselt experiences mild, often gray and drizzly maritime weather with limited sunshine, similar to other inland Belgian cities.
πŸŒͺ️ Natural Disaster Risk + 9.2 -- 10 Belgium is geologically stable with very low risk of earthquakes, hurricanes, or major natural disasters.
🏞️ Green Spaces + 8.2 -- 10 Hasselt is known as the 'Capital of Taste' and features extensive parks, the famous Japanese Garden, and easy access to the Hoge Kempen National Park.
❄️ Air Conditioning + 4.1 -- 15 Air conditioning is not standard in residential buildings or older cafes due to the historically temperate climate, though heatwaves are becoming more frequent.
πŸ‚ Seasonal Variety + 6.1 -- 10 Distinct four-season cycle with cold, damp winters and pleasant, lush springs and summers, though winter sunlight is notably minimal.
πŸ”Š Noise Pollution + 6.7 -- 10 As a mid-sized, bike-friendly city, the urban core is relatively calm compared to major capitals, though traffic noise exists on arterial roads.
🎭 CULTURE & ENTERTAINMENT
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
🎭 Culture + 7.5 -- 20 Hasselt offers a sophisticated blend of contemporary art at Z33, the renowned Jenever Museum, and a historic city center that balances Flemish heritage with modern design.
πŸŒƒ Nightlife + 5.5 -- 15 The city features a surprisingly vibrant 'Groenplein' and 'Zuivelmarkt' area with numerous bars, cafes, and clubs that cater to a lively local student population.
🏞️ Outdoors & Nature + 7.6 -- 15 Home to the largest Japanese Garden in Europe and proximity to the Hoge Kempen National Park, the city provides excellent cycling infrastructure and green urban spaces.
πŸ—£οΈ Language Learning Opportunities + 6.8 -- 10 While Dutch is the primary language, locals are highly proficient in English, and the proximity to the PXL University of Applied Sciences provides structured Dutch language course options.
🧭 Local Experiences & Tours + 7.1 -- 10 Visitors can engage in authentic experiences like jenever tasting workshops, street art walking tours, and exploring the nearby Bokrijk open-air museum.
🎳 Indoors Fun + 6.5 -- 10 Hasselt provides reliable indoor entertainment, including high-quality shopping streets, large indoor swimming facilities, and frequent cultural events at the Trixxo Arena.

πŸ“ˆ BUSINESS & ECONOMY
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
πŸš€ Startup Scene + 5.4 -- 15 Hasselt benefits from its proximity to major Flemish innovation hubs and the Corda Campus, which provides a strong environment for tech and service-oriented startups. While smaller than Brussels or Antwerp, it maintains a supportive infrastructure for entrepreneurs.
πŸ’³ Local Payment Services + 9.3 -- 10 Belgium features highly sophisticated banking and payment infrastructure, with near-universal acceptance of Bancontact, contactless cards, and mobile payment apps like Payconiq. Cash is rarely required, making it extremely convenient for digital nomads.
πŸ”— Blockchain & Crypto Adoption + 5.5 -- 15 Belgium has a pragmatic, regulated approach to crypto with increasing institutional interest and availability of exchanges. While not a global crypto hub, the local digital ecosystem is well-integrated with modern fintech standards.
πŸš† TRANSPORTATION
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
✈️ Airport Connectivity + 7.2 -- 30 Hasselt lacks its own airport but is well-connected by rail to Brussels Airport (BRU) within 60-70 minutes and is within reasonable reach of Eindhoven and Liège airports.
πŸš‡ Public Transit + 7.7 -- 20 The city features a reliable bus network operated by De Lijn, though it relies heavily on the railway station for regional connections.
🚢 Walkability + 8.0 -- 20 The historic city center is compact, pedestrian-friendly, and features significant car-free zones that make navigating on foot very pleasant.
πŸš— Ride-sharing Services + 5.1 -- 15 Uber and similar platforms have limited availability in smaller Belgian cities like Hasselt, making traditional taxis the primary motorized option.
🚲 Cycling + 9.2 -- 10 Hasselt is exceptionally bike-friendly, featuring an extensive network of dedicated cycle paths and a flat topography that makes cycling the local preference.
πŸš„ Intercity Travel Options + 8.2 -- 15 Excellent rail connectivity allows for quick, direct train travel to major hubs like Antwerp, Brussels, and LiΓ¨ge, integrating well with the national network.

βš–οΈ LEGAL & ADMINISTRATIVE
Factor Score Trend Weight Notes
πŸ›‚ Visa Ease + 5.8 -- 40 As part of the Schengen Area, non-EU nomads face standard, relatively strict visa requirements; access is easy for those with EU citizenship but paperwork-heavy for others.
πŸ“Š Tax Friendliness + 4.1 -- 30 Belgium has some of the highest personal income tax rates in the world, making it financially challenging for high-earning digital nomads.
πŸ—£οΈ Freedom of Speech + 9.0 -- 15 Belgium maintains robust legal protections for expression and a free press, consistently ranking among the top countries globally.
πŸ›οΈ Political Stability + 8.1 -- 20 Despite frequent complex government formation processes, the country remains highly stable with strong institutions and rule of law.
🏦 Ease of Opening Bank Account + 5.5 -- 15 Opening an account as a non-resident can be difficult due to strict KYC and AML regulations, often requiring a local address and Belgian ID.
πŸ“„ Ease of Business Registration + 5.8 -- 10 The process is well-regulated but involves significant administrative bureaucracy, requires a local notary, and entails high initial capital and social security obligations.
πŸ“„βœˆοΈ Digital Nomad Visa Availability + 3.6 -- 35 Belgium does not offer a specific digital nomad visa, forcing remote workers to rely on standard long-stay visa categories which are not tailored for this lifestyle.
